SERVice
The commands of the SERVice system are used for maintenance or test purposes. They were
implemented primarily to support device development. The numeric suffix refers to the sensors.
Note:
Before commands of the SERVice system can be sent to a sensor, they
must be enabled via the
SERVice:UNLock 1234
command.

SERVice[1..4]:CALibration:TEST? <NR1>
Tests the consistency of the calibration data set according to three criteria:
If the following bit is set in <NR1>,
the following action is executed.
0 The serial number of the calibration data set is tested.
1 The checksum of the calibration data set is tested.
2 The header of the calibration data set is tested.
If an inconsistency of the data set is detected, the query returns a
1
, otherwise a
0
.
Value range:
0 to 255
*RST
value:
none
SERVice[1..4]:CALibration:TEMP ONCE
Initiates a temperature measurement of the sensor in question. The temperature can be queried with
SERV:CAL:TEMP:DATA?
.
SERVice[1..4]:CALibration:TEMP:DATA? <NR1>
Returns the temperature of the sensor in Kelvin if a temperature measurement was previously initiated
by means of
SERV:CAL:TEMP ONCE
.
